JOB DESCRIPTION

 

Duties
Assess the different assumptions and approaches presently used in the infrared and microwave radiative transfer, by comparing observed and simulated observations using the ARTS (Atmospheric Radiative Transfer Simulator) research tool.
Based on the findings, develop particle model parametrisations for different cloud regimes, suitable to reach the project’s objectives.
Take part in incorporating new models into cloud retrievals made at Chalmers and SMHI, as well as supporting ECMWF to add the models into the operational RTTOV-SCATT observation operator.
